Is Pera Wallet safe?

Pera Wallet is self-custody: the private key is yours, and so is the responsibility. Nobody can restore it if you lose the recovery phrase. The code is open source, so the security claims can be checked independently. We do not audit wallets — check the wallet's own security page and recent independent reviews before storing a meaningful amount.

What does it cost to move coins into Pera Wallet?

Pera Wallet does not charge you to receive. The cost is the withdrawal fee at the exchange you are sending from, which is a flat amount of the coin and differs a lot between exchanges and between networks — sending over Algorand is often far cheaper or far more expensive than the alternatives.
